.elementor-15301 .elementor-element.elementor-element-3df488b >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-15301 .elementor-element.elementor-element-3df488b > .elementor-container{min-height:550px;}.elementor-15301 .elementor-element.elementor-element-fc37202: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-15301 .elementor-element.elementor-element-fc37202 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://we-building.org/wp-content/uploads/2026/03/ChatGPT-Image-9.-Marz-2026-12_44_06.png");background-position:center center;background-size:cover;}.elementor-15301 .elementor-element.elementor-element-fc37202.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-15301 .elementor-element.elementor-element-fc37202 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-block-end:0px;}.elementor-15301 .elementor-element.elementor-element-fc37202 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0px 0px 0px 0px;}.elementor-15301 .elementor-element.elementor-element-fc37202 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);}.elementor-15301 .elementor-element.elementor-element-08bc168: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-15301 .elementor-element.elementor-element-08bc168 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#000000;}.elementor-15301 .elementor-element.elementor-element-08bc168.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-15301 .elementor-element.elementor-element-08bc168 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-block-end:0px;}.elementor-15301 .elementor-element.elementor-element-08bc168 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:16px 0px 0px 12px;}.elementor-15301 .elementor-element.elementor-element-08bc168 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-widget-text-editor{color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-15301 .elementor-element.elementor-element-05c1ef9{width:var( --container-widget-width, 100.369% );max-width:100.369%;--container-widget-width:100.369%;--container-widget-flex-grow:0;line-height:1.1em;}.elementor-15301 .elementor-element.elementor-element-05c1ef9 > .elementor-widget-container{margin:16px 5px 12px 3px;padding:0px 5px 0px 0px;}.elementor-15301 .elementor-element.elementor-element-05c1ef9.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-4f69a67{margin-top:20px;margin-bottom:15px;}.elementor-15301 .elementor-element.elementor-element-b2ff426 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-15301 .elementor-element.elementor-element-fe14d34 > .elementor-widget-container{border-radius:0px 0px 0px 0px;}.elementor-15301 .elementor-element.elementor-element-fe14d34{text-align:justify;}.elementor-15301 .elementor-element.elementor-element-96929f8{text-align:center;}.elementor-15301 .elementor-element.elementor-element-3df87c9{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;}.elementor-15301 .elementor-element.elementor-element-3df87c9.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-f73afb5{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--flex-wrap:wrap;}.elementor-15301 .elementor-element.elementor-element-8c2762d{--display:flex;}.elementor-15301 .elementor-element.elementor-element-8c2762d.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-989120d{--display:flex;}.elementor-15301 .elementor-element.elementor-element-989120d.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-0d21544 > .elementor-widget-container{padding:13px 13px 13px 13px;}.elementor-15301 .elementor-element.elementor-element-64371e6{width:var( --container-widget-width, 98.311% );max-width:98.311%;--container-widget-width:98.311%;--container-widget-flex-grow:0;}.elementor-15301 .elementor-element.elementor-element-64371e6 > .elementor-widget-container{padding:13px 13px 13px 13px;}.elementor-15301 .elementor-element.elementor-element-64371e6.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-0705902{--display:flex;}.elementor-15301 .elementor-element.elementor-element-0705902.e-con{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-30e4bc4{width:var( --container-widget-width, 112.142% );max-width:112.142%;--container-widget-width:112.142%;--container-widget-flex-grow:0;}.elementor-15301 .elementor-element.elementor-element-30e4bc4 > .elementor-widget-container{margin:-8px -8px -8px -8px;}.elementor-15301 .elementor-element.elementor-element-30e4bc4.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-15301 .elementor-element.elementor-element-11dada2{--display:flex;}@media(max-width:767px){.elementor-15301 .elementor-element.elementor-element-05c1ef9 > .elementor-widget-container{margin:14px 0px 0px 0px;}.elementor-15301 .elementor-element.elementor-element-b2ff426 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-15301 .elementor-element.elementor-element-fe14d34 > .elementor-widget-container{margin:0px 10px 0px 10px;}}@media(min-width:768px){.elementor-15301 .elementor-element.elementor-element-fc37202{width:77%;}.elementor-15301 .elementor-element.elementor-element-08bc168{width:23%;}.elementor-15301 .elementor-element.elementor-element-b8fe6ae{width:10%;}.elementor-15301 .elementor-element.elementor-element-b2ff426{width:80%;}.elementor-15301 .elementor-element.elementor-element-8939d26{width:9.332%;}.elementor-15301 .elementor-element.elementor-element-df08820{width:10%;}.elementor-15301 .elementor-element.elementor-element-e0cc098{width:79.332%;}.elementor-15301 .elementor-element.elementor-element-04ac682{width:10%;}.elementor-15301 .elementor-element.elementor-element-cf02c30{width:10%;}.elementor-15301 .elementor-element.elementor-element-5b8b29e{width:79.332%;}.elementor-15301 .elementor-element.elementor-element-0d48ff4{width:10%;}.elementor-15301 .elementor-element.elementor-element-e5ceb3e{width:10%;}.elementor-15301 .elementor-element.elementor-element-26e3e58{width:80%;}.elementor-15301 .elementor-element.elementor-element-a575b08{width:9.332%;}.elementor-15301 .elementor-element.elementor-element-8c2762d{--width:49.156%;}.elementor-15301 .elementor-element.elementor-element-989120d{--width:102.338%;}.elementor-15301 .elementor-element.elementor-element-0705902{--width:43.054%;}}/* Start custom CSS for text-editor, class: .elementor-element-05c1ef9 */@media (min-width:100px) {
  h1 {
    font-size: 30px !important;
  }
  
}
@media (min-width:768px) {
  h1 {
    font-size: 36px !important;
  }
}
@media (min-width:1024px) {
  h1 {
    font-size: 38px !important;
  }
}
@media (min-width:1280px) {
  h1 {
    font-size: 40px !important;
  }
}
@media (min-width:1600px) {
  h1 {
    font-size: 42px !important;
  }
}
@media (min-width:100px) {
  h2 {margin-top:-10px;
    font-size: 24px !important;
  }
  
}
@media (min-width:768px) {
  h2 {margin-top:-10px;
    font-size: 24px !important;
  }
}
@media (min-width:1024px) {
  h2 {margin-top:-10px;
    font-size: 26px !important;
  }
}
@media (min-width:1280px) {
  h2 {margin-top:-10px;
    font-size: 28px !important;
  }
}
@media (min-width:1600px) {
  h2 {margin-top:-10px; 
    font-size: 30px !important;
  }
}
@media (min-width:100px) {
  p {margin-top:-16px;
  line-height: 150%!important;
    font-size: 14px !important;
  }
  
}
@media (min-width:768px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 16px !important;
  }
  
}
@media (min-width:1024px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 18px !important;
  }
  
}
@media (min-width:1280px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 20px !important;
  }
  
}
@media (min-width:1600px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 22px !important;
  }
  
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-fe14d34 */@media (min-width:100px) {
  h1 {
    font-size: 30px !important;
  }
  
}
@media (min-width:768px) {
  h1 {
    font-size: 36px !important;
  }
}
@media (min-width:1024px) {
  h1 {
    font-size: 38px !important;
  }
}
@media (min-width:1280px) {
  h1 {
    font-size: 40px !important;
  }
}
@media (min-width:1600px) {
  h1 {
    font-size: 42px !important;
  }
}
@media (min-width:100px) {
  h2 {margin-top:-10px;
    font-size: 24px !important;
  }
  
}
@media (min-width:768px) {
  h2 {margin-top:-10px;
    font-size: 24px !important;
  }
}
@media (min-width:1024px) {
  h2 {margin-top:-10px;
    font-size: 26px !important;
  }
}
@media (min-width:1280px) {
  h2 {margin-top:-10px;
    font-size: 28px !important;
  }
}
@media (min-width:1600px) {
  h2 {margin-top:-10px; 
    font-size: 30px !important;
  }
}
@media (min-width:100px) {
  p {margin-top:-16px;
  line-height: 150%!important;
    font-size: 14px !important;
  }
  
}
@media (min-width:768px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 16px !important;
  }
  
}
@media (min-width:1024px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 18px !important;
  }
  
}
@media (min-width:1280px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 20px !important;
  }
  
}
@media (min-width:1600px) {
  p {margin-top:-16px;!important;
  line-height: 150%!important;
    font-size: 22px !important;
  }
  
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-4f69a67 */html,
body{
width:100%;
overflow-x:hidden;
}/* End custom CSS */